Inactivation of Icmt inhibits transformation by oncogenic K-Ras and B-Raf
Isoprenylcysteine carboxyl methyltransferase (Icmt) methylates the carboxyl-terminal isoprenylcysteine of CAAX proteins (e.g., Ras and Rho proteins).
